Identity Theft Costs More to Clean Up

September 24, 2003 - Privacy News

The Identity Theft Resource Center reports that even though identity theft victims are discovering the crime faster than they were three years ago, they are spending more time and money to clean up the damage. Individuals now spend approximately $1,495 and approximately 175 hours.

The average cost to business is now approximately $92,900 compared to about $18,000 in 2000.
